    Halifax Bank

    Amount Claimed : £578 Charges + £215.86 Interest

    Amount Recieved :£500

    Requested statements for my Halifax account at the end of march, sent a letter along with a £10 cheque , which they cashed and the statements arrived 14 days later.
    Sent first letter requesting charges and interest on 12th April stating they had 14 days to respond.
    Recieved usual reply we have 8 weeks etc
    Sent second letter 27th April saying i had not had a satisfactory response giving them another 14 days then going to court.
    Recieved second letter stating same as first , 8 weeks etc
    Decided to wait as couldn't afford court ,after 8 weeks was up ,recieved the your getting nothing letter, so telephoned them and said i was preparing court as we spoke, the following day got an offer for £289 , phoned again saying this offer was unacceptable and the offer was upped to £450 ,phoned again today and spoke to someone else and told the most i could have was £500 ,so i have settled for that.
    Not bad for the price of 2 stamps and 3 phone calls.

    There has been no mention of account being closed but they have cut my credit card limit right down to the amount i owe on it ( its now £2000 less than it was) but i wont be using it again anyway HA!.

    Bank: First Direct
    Amount Reclaimed:£1425.99 (inc interest) £1187.50 (without)
    Amount they paid: £1030.00
    The story:Sent first letter 24th May with £10 cheque for statements they didn't want the cheque for statements sent the statements back within about 2 weeks ttted up charges very simply with the help of Martin's calculator (many thanks!) sent the letter off with the charges outlined on the 12th June received the letter this morning saying no responsibilty admitted blah, blah but would pay us back £1030.00.
